In terms of state-to-state migration, California topped the list with over 102,000 people moving to Texas. Meanwhile, New York came in second, as more than 91,000 of its residents moved to Florida.Florida also received over 250,000 migrants from foreign countries, coming second to California (298,151 migrants) and placing above Texas (233,751 migrants).
However, it’s not clear what countries these international migrants stem from. The bureau doesn’t distinguish between legal status for foreign migrants, and these three states have historically been top destinations for undocumented migration.
In total, more than 1 million people moved to the Sunshine State in 2022.
The list of states with residents who moved to Florida is as follows:
1 New York 91,201 2 California 50,701 3 New Jersey 47,000 4 Georgia 39,990 5 Texas 38,207 6 Pennsylvania 35,384 7 Illinois 35,262 8 Virginia 32,932 9 Ohio 27,257 10 North Carolina 24,601 11 Michigan 23,781 12 Maryland 23,422 13 Colorado 20,980 14 Tennessee 20,651 15 Massachusetts 20,320 16 South Carolina 14,825 17 Alabama 14,734 18 Connecticut 13,620 19 Arizona 11,901 20 Washington 11,804 More than 1 million people moved to the Sunshine State last year, including those from other states and foreign countries.
U.S. Census data show that the majority of those moving to Florida (91,201 individuals) came from New York, followed by Califonia (50,701 individuals) and New Jersey (47,000 individuals).Jun 10, 2024
Florida is a popular destination for movers — in 2023, the state's population grew by 1.6%, or 365,205 residents, the second highest population growth in the U.S. Florida has the 13th highest personal consumption expenditure, which measures the cost of goods and services for a household, in the U.S Apr 23, 2024
Florida had the highest net migration increase of all states in 2022, gaining a net population of 249,064 people.
In 2022, 738,969 people moved to Florida, according to the U.S. Census Bureau. However, 489,905 people moved out of Florida that same year, resulting in a net positive migration of 249,064 people. National net migration in 2022 was highest in Florida, followed by Texas, North Carolina, Arizona and Georgia.7 days ago
